T. C. Boyle was born in 1948 and served as a Distinguished Professor of English at the University of Southern California. He is a regular contributor to The New Yorker and the author of more than twenty novels and short-story collections. His novel World's End won the PEN/Faulkner Award, and Drop City was a finalist for the National Book Award. East Is East (1990) explores cross-cultural collision through the story of a Japanese seaman who washes ashore on a Georgian barrier island.
